2017/18 FA Cup and FA Vase draws due this week

How it works and what you can expect from the draws

Friday promises to be a busy morning for the Football Association as they release the early round draws for it’s national competitions.

The FA Cup, Trophy, Vase and Youth Cup draws are all expected at midday on Friday and we’ll bring you the news of who will face who right here on FootballinBracknell.

Not all of the clubs covered on FiB will enter the national tournaments – last season saw the three of Ascot United, Binfield and Bracknell Town enter the FA Cup while they were joined by Eversley & California, Sandhurst Town and Woodley United in the FA Vase.

How it works

We’re a long way from the live draw on the BBC with celebrity guests. As far as we know the draw for the early round is completed with scraps of paper from a Tupperware tub (or more likely via computer). But here’s what you can expect on Friday.

For the FA Cup, the FA will draw the Extra Preliminary Round and Preliminary Rounds and release them simultaneously.

Similarly in the FA Vase, the First and Second Qualifying Round fixtures are expected simultaneously.

What else?

The draws for the competitions are regionalised meaning you can expect a terrific derby or two from the draw.

Last season saw Bracknell Town come from behind at Thatcham Town to win 3-2 in the FA Cup Extra Preliminary Round while the Robins and Binfield met in the Second Qualifying Round of the FA Vase.
